Story

Alices Arc is a childrens cancer charity.

The primary aim is to fund research into finding more targeted and less harsh treatments for rhabdomyosarcoma by working with centres of excellence for cancer research and treatment. This involves funding salaries of Scientists, Research Assistants and Research Nurses involved in ground-breaking clinical trials from the laboratory to the hospital. In addition they provide equipment and materials to support this work. They also support the children and families impacted by this disease by providing medicines and support that help ease the treatment process. Please support them.
